Why is this an amazing opportunity for you

Motion Fluid Power Fabrication & Onsite Services Technician is a diverse role, where no day is the same. We are a leading service and technical provider for Mining, Hydraulic, Petrochem and Food & beverage industries throughout New Zealand.

Motion New Zealand is a business operating across the Asia Pacific region including New Zealand, Australia, Indonesia and Singapore who provide a range of industrial products & engineering services to industry to keep the world moving!

We are in growth mode with a clear 2027 growth strategy to expand our reach into industry across the region. Motion is investing in the Capability & Development of our people to enable the delivery of this growth strategy, meaning plenty of opportunity to work and develop your skills and knowledge.

Key responsibilities

  • Ensure all hose assemblies are manufactured to the correct standard and within the required timeframe to meet customer requirements
  • Periodic overnight travel throughout the South Island to customer sites, inspecting and certifying hose assemblies to the specified standard
  • Upkeep workshop presentation (including vehicles) to a high standard
  • Raise awareness of all Motion services and realise site-work potential
  • Ensuring our companies reputation as a market leader is promoted through prompt and courteous service and the highest standards of workmanship.

Ideal skills & experience:

  • Excellent mechanical aptitude and verbal communication
  • Reliable, team player and positive can-do attitude
  • Valid full driver's & forklift licence
  • Great customer service skills. Able to follow procedures, systems and solve problems
  • Physically fit to meet the requirements of the role.

About Us
Motion Australia is the leader in the distribution of Bearings, Power Transmission, Driveshafts, Hose & Fittings, services and repairs, and industrial supplies to engineering, mining, transport, defence, manufacturers, civil infrastructure, and the trades, serviced by our 70 plus strategically located Branches around Australia.
Motion is part of a Global family with operations across Australia, New Zealand, Indonesia, Singapore, North America and Europe.
